Pre-race routine:

The race started at 9am, waves every 30min throughout 1pm
My wave was 11am, together with me started both Ralfs from the club
The Lenz brothers were on at 10am, Uli at 10:30am, Merat at 11:30am, Thomas, Toni, Joe and Karsten at 12:30am, so the club was spread out over the whole day
I arrived at 9am with lots of time. After getting my start package, I wanted to set up my bike. Blew my rear tire when checking the pressure, I changed the tire right at the car, was upset but had lots of time
Between setting up T and trying to see friends start and finish their swim, time went by fast and I finally got to the pool with about 10min to spend
Did a few strokes to warm up
When everybody was in the water, I asked around for expected swim times and this way we sorted and I was able to go first

Swim
  • 16m 48s
  • 950 meters
  • 01m 46s / 100 meters
Comments:

We were 7 people in a 50m lane, actually not too bad, I was clearly the fastest in the lane and after discussing expected swim times I started first. Had to lap most folks only once, stayed behind a group for the last half lane, did not want to risk anything for 2 or 3 seconds

What would you do differently?:

After all, I enjoyed the swim because I could mostly swim at my own pace and by myself, nothing to change really

Bike
  • 1h 25m 40s
  • 43.9 kms
  • 30.75 km/hr
Comments:

The wind SUCKED (25kph, gusts up to 50kph)
The occasional rain sucked even more, especially the short rain towards the end, felt like hail and sucked energy

About 5km in I felt my rear tire acting up, decided to stop to check if something was broken. It turned out that the new tube was slightly expanded at the valve

Also, the hills were very tough for me, there was a group of about 5 guys, 1 in particular, who were passing me on the uphills, and I then I would pass on the downhills

One part of the loop was on a high plane, going straight into the wind for 1km or so, I was actually doing pretty well there and passed people
What would you do differently?:

Switch off wind and rain
Loose weight to get up hills faster

Run
  • 50m 58s
  • 10.2 kms
  • 04m  min/km
Comments:

this felt like one of my best runs, if not the best run ever
Using the Zoots felt great and fast, I think I had great form, at least for the first 8km
Unlike on other runs, I was passing people, even some who looked "serious"
The weather had cleared by now, no more rain and some sun
Around km6, I felt my left ankle rubbing against the shoes and knew that I would "draw blood", I continued to be a bother, but nothing serious
I was just thinking: "from now on I should be running less so that I race faster when.... right at the last turnaround, just under 8km, from step to the next I felt a light sting in the biceps femoris. For the next 1.5km it was little more than a nuisance, but then it started to really hurt, was even limping

The GPS came up shorter than 10.5km, no matter what I was running 10k under 50min!!
What would you do differently?:

I probably DO need to run more to prepare the biomechanics for race stress
